Splish splash


In the middle of the night our dear Dutchess came home..she entered through the Kitchen door...dropped her bags on the doorstep...and sighed.
It had been a long long day and she was very tired. What I need now is a cup of hot cocoa before I go to bed..she said to herself. She turned up the lights and walked towards the stove...

-O how lovely...Tomato soup...Gustave must have made this today..he is such a darling...but...well..as always he made a terrible mess...there's soup everywhere..!

Then...the Dutchess found something very peculiar...on the stove,next to the pot of soup she saw tiny footprints...

-Strange,she whispered...tomato soup footprints....

Suddenly....a noise behind her startled her! It came from under the doormat..

-Dearest..Its me ,Miss Moussie...I can't get in ...your bags are in the way..Yoehoe..
Quickly The Dutches removed her belongings from the doormat and helped Miss Moussie enter the kitchen.
-So Happy to see you ,squeaked miss Moussie..brushing of her coat..you know dearest its quit dusty under this mat..you should sweep the floor more often.
-This I will do..said the Dutchess with a smile...My dear Miss Moussie its so good to see you again..and at this time a night...did I wake you up..
-No No...I wanted to say goodnight ...and to be sure you are fine..
-This is so sweet of you my dear Miss M...I was going to make myself a cup of cocoa..would you like to join me? And now that you are here...there is something I must tell you..I discovered something very strange...
-You did...squeaked Miss Moussie...and what might this be..
-Look..said the Dutchess pointing at the stove...footprints...tomato soup footprints...and they look familiar..
-O dear...twittered Miss Moussie...not Gustave again..I told him not to spill the soup..and now you tell me he even walked through it..
-No dearest..I wasn't Gustave..these footprints are to tiny..I did see them before,when I was a little girl...These footprints are from...a Gnome..
-O Goodness me...twittered Miss Moussie nervously...is it HIM...the humming Gnome....just a few ours ago we were talking about him...at this table..I wonder..
-Wonder WHAT..dear Miss M..do you think he was all ready here...in the Kitchen..listening to what you were saying ..
-This could very well be possible...said Miss Moussie...and when Gustave and I were cleaning up the Kitchen..something fell in the soup...
-AHAA,said the Dutchess...you are so clever Miss Watson..this was elementary..this explains the footprints..the Gnome fell in the soup!
-He did..twittered Miss Moussie..and this means we have to solve the next problem...
-So we do...so we do...said the dutches taking a sip of her cocoa...just where might this Gnome be...

-I am staying the night...I am not going to leave you alone with this creature..I will be back in a jiffy...just going to get my pyjamas....twittered Miss Moussie whilst she took a dive under the doormat ...
Within minutes she came back..in her robe...
-Darling,this is so sweet of you but I am sure I will be fine...I know this little fellow..he was always very nice to me..
-Gnome's are not to be trusted and I find them very suspicious..twittered Miss Moussie with a firm tone of voice...I am staying!
-Very well then..You can sleep next to me....This will be fun...a pyjama party..Come ..lets go upstairs..its very late and us girls we do need our beauty sleep..

It was a dark night on Hilltop Hall...nothing was stirring..not even a mouse..
Well..not this time...the Mousse in question was very jumpy and nervous..She was laying in bed ..listening to every sound..watching every shadow..
The Dutchess was sound a sleep...you only could see her nose above the blankets and a whirl of tangled curly hair..
-I must stay awake...whispered Miss Moussie...I don't like Gnome's..you never know what they are up to..She started counting sheep...this to help her NOT to fall in sleep..
-Thousand and one ,thousand and two, thousand and four, thousand and..WHAT WAS THAT...
Miss Moussie jumped up and started to run to the Dutchess...this wasn't easy to do in such a big soft fluffy pillow..she almost disappeared in it...It was like she had to climb a very high mountain...She struggled to reach the Dutchess...she crawled next to the Dutchess's ear and pulled it..whispering...Dearest..wake up...wake up..listen, do you hear what I hear..?
-The Dutchess opened her eyes..its him ,she said..I can hear him humming..its the Gnome..
-O Dear ...O Dear...squeaked Miss Moussie...Now what...and then she slipped under the blankets..mumbling..I think I will stay here for a while..
-That's a good idea..whispered the Dutchess..wait there..Don't worry..I will be right back....I think these humming sounds are coming from the bathroom...Then she stepped out of bed and tiptoed towards the door...
Miss Moussie couldn't stand the suspense...she ran after the Dutchess as fast as she possibly could....Then ,they very slowly opened the bathroom door...to see splishing and splashing in the bathroom sink..a tiny Gnome...taking a bath..whilst humming a merry tune..

Together,Miss Moussie and the Dutchess yelled OOOOooOOOoooo....
The Gnome in the sink...scared out of his wits by these two ladies ....yelled..AAAAaaaaaaaaH...and then he jumped...into the Dutchess her hair.....

-He's in you hair, he's in your hair...Squeaked Miss Moussie....
-Get out of there..you silly Gnome..get out..said the Dutchess...OUT NOW...

Then they heard a tiny voice hum...No can't do...I am not decent.....
